Booing the national anthem left ESPN and WWE commentator Pat McAfee fuming.
“These are the most stacked Elimination Chambers that the WWE has ever had,” McAfee said.
He then described Canada as a “terrible country.”
“Kinda sucks that it’s in the terrible country of Canada that booed our national anthem to start this entire thing!” he said. “But it’s gonna be a historic night for the WWE on the road to WrestleMania.”
